Man City 3-0 Arsenal Highlights
Arsenal’s turbulent week ended in more misery as Manchester City sent them to a fifth league defeat of the season.

The Gunners, who dropped skipper William Gallas after his midweek outburst, looked to be in freefall.
Stephen Ireland clipped in City’s first after Gael Clichy sliced a clearance, and Robinho doubled the lead when he superbly chipped Manuel Almunia.
Robinho had a shot cleared off the line before Daniel Sturridge scored with a penalty after he had been fouled.
Arsenal’s build-up to the match was blighted by Gallas’ public claims that his team lacks spirit and togetherness, while City had won only once in five league games.
Gallas paid a heavy price for his comments, but his absence at the heart of the defence also cost the Gunners as they imploded for City’s opener.
